North Korea fires unidentified projectile

North Korea has fired at least one unidentified short-range projectile from its eastern coast. A US defence official says it resembles the firing of two-short range missiles in May. South Korea's joint chiefs have confirmed it was fired from an area near Wonsan and landed in the Sea of Japan. Image: AP
